Description

Position Summary: A professional in Administration or related fields, with 5 years of experience leading Human Resource Management, responsible for HR processes, recruitment, payroll, and employee well-being. Key Highlights: 1. Lead key Human Resource Management and employee well-being processes. 2. Extensive experience in recruitment, hiring, and payroll. 3. Foster a positive and efficient work environment. • EDUCATION: Degree in Administration, Engineering, Law, Psychology, or related fields • TRAINING: Human Resources Administration, Social Security Settlement, Staff Affiliation and Hiring, Payroll. • EXPERIENCE: five years (5) • EQUIVALENCE: 5 years of experience leading the HR area • SKILLS: Teamwork, Initiative, Creativity, Prudence, Proactivity, Stress and tension management, Creative thinking, Critical thinking, Self-awareness, Empathy, Assertive communication. • TRAINING: Not applicable • ADDITIONAL REQUIREMENTS: As specified by the client. FUNCTIONS AND RESPONSIBILITIES • Ensure confidentiality of company information • Conduct onboarding and training to strengthen the company's workforce competencies • Receive, register, classify, and distribute documentation entering and exiting Human Resource Management. • Administer information systems and files related to the department. • Organize and manage executive schedules and communications, coordinating scheduled activities. • Manage and organize corporate events, meetings, and other activities promoting human well-being • Archive, retrieve, and process incoming or outgoing documentation; track files or proceedings. • Maintain updated files and databases corresponding to the department. • Enter data into the respective database (World Office), update personnel information and payroll updates. • Serve internal and external users, either in person or by phone, according to departmental scope. • Support administrative services for other company members. • Process information that supports various functions within the department. • Collect, prepare, and update reports and documents related to personnel activities (e.g., recruitment, termination, absences, infractions, complaints, etc.). • Carry out the recruitment process. • Post job vacancies. • Collect applicant information and deliver it to relevant departments based on profile requests. • Contact potential candidates and schedule job interviews. • Verify applicant data, including academic background, work experience, and references, among others. • Conduct necessary follow-up for each candidate. • Carry out the hiring process. • Prepare the new employee's file. • Confirm completeness of submitted documentation. • Support necessary onboarding about the company for new employees and resolve their questions and concerns. • Maintain records of employee files, complaints, and claims in general. • Complete documentation related to termination of employment.
